    178, ARGYLE STREET SOUTH, BIRKENHEAD, CH41 9BZ

    This terraced freehold property on Argyle Street South last sold in February 2026 for £110,000. Based on price growth in the CH41 district since then, its estimated current value is £110,000 — placing it in the 3rd percentile nationally and the 31st percentile within CH41. The property covers 68 m² (732 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£1,618 per m². The EPC rating is E, with a potential rating of C.
